Burney suffered their closest defeat since May 9, 2025 on Friday. They fell just short of the Portola Tigers by a score of 3-1. The matchup marked the Raiders' lowest-scoring game so far this season.
Alyssa Hawkins made the most of her time in the batter's box despite the final result and went 2-for-3 with one home run. That home run was her first of the season.
This is the second loss in a row for Burney and nudges their season record down to 4-3-2. Even worse, they were so close both times: the losses came by an average of only 1.5 runs. As for Portola, the win keeps them at an undefeated 6-0.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Burney will look to takes advantage of their home field for the first time this season as they takes on Weed at 2: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Portola, they will challenge Lakeview at 3: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
